You will be picked up from your Batanes accommodation at 12 PM. After being picked up, you’ll kick off your tour with a welcome lunch. Once you’ve had your fill, you’ll head to Tukon Chapel in Basco. Also known as Mt. Carmel Chapel, the structure is made of stone and was designed with Ivatan stone houses as an inspiration. Its unique look, coupled with its location atop a hill, make it a favorite location for Batanes weddings.

Next, you’ll head to the PAGASA Tukon Radar Station. During your visit to the northernmost Philippine Atmospheric Geophysical and Astronomical Services Administration station, you’ll see different equipment that helps measure and predict the weather. But the best part about this station is its 360-degree view of Batan Island.

You’ll then head to the Japanese Tunnel that Japanese soldiers used as shelter during World War II. After that, you’ll visit Valugan Boulder Beach. As its name suggests, this beach is not home to powdery sand but instead is filled with smooth round boulders. Take in the stunning view before heading to Basco Cathedral. Also known as Sto. Domingo Church and Our Lady of Immaculate Conception Cathedral, it is the first church built in Batanes. 

Your next stop is Basco Lighthouse, a picturesque six-story structure on top of Naidi Hill. On the fifth floor is a viewing deck that can give you beautiful views of the island of Batan. You’ll then head to your last stop, the Vayang Rolling Hills. The hills will not only give you breathtaking views of its verdant slopes but also of the waters surrounding Batan Island. Enjoy the fresh air and the cool temperatures before heading back to your accommodations with your driver.
